Offer description

At OptiGrid, we’re building the tech to significantly improve the economics of grid-connected batteries and accelerate the clean energy transition. Through years of research and development, we’ve built a proprietary market forecasting and battery optimisation platform that substantially outperforms the status quo in the National Electricity Market (NEM).

Backed by prominent deep-tech and clean-tech investors, our team combining software engineering with deep NEM, forecasting, and energy market expertise is growing - and we’re looking for a (Mid-Level to Senior) Software Engineer to help us scale the platform.

This is an incredible opportunity to become an early and foundational team member at a climate-tech company that is at a growth inflection point, addressing a critical problem in one of the most important and fastest-growing markets.


What you’ll do

Collaborate closely with software engineers, data scientists, and energy market experts to deliver new product features and improvements.

Productionise forecasting and optimisation models in Python, ensuring they are robust, scalable, and production-ready.

Develop and maintain the data pipelines powering our forecasting, optimisation, and bidding workflows.

Set standards and establish best practices for our production codebase on AWS infrastructure using modern DevOps practices.


What you’ll bring

5+ years of Python experience, including strong fluency with Python’s numerical ecosystem (e.g. Pandas, Polars, NumPy).

3+ years of working in technical teams, building data pipelines, delivering productionised code, and building or maintaining live applications.

Experience with AWS microservices, containerisation (Docker), CI/CD automation (e.g. GitHub Actions), and Python-based API development (e.g. FastAPI).

Knowledge of infrastructure-as-code tools (e.g. Terraform).

A collaborative, curious mindset and a willingness to work across disciplines.

Experience working with power systems, energy markets, or NEM/AEMO data.

Exposure to mathematical optimisation libraries.

Experience building ML pipelines or working with time series data.
